45,323,718,554,047 is a prime number. Like all primes greater than two, it is odd and has no factors apart from itself and one.

Names of 45323718554047

  • Cardinal: 45323718554047 can be written as Forty-five trillion, three hundred twenty-three billion, seven hundred eighteen million, five hundred fifty-four thousand and forty-seven.

Scientific notation

  • Scientific notation: 4.5323718554047 × 1013

Factors of 45323718554047

  • Number of distinct prime factors ω(n): 1
  • Total number of prime factors Ω(n): 1
  • Sum of prime factors: 45323718554047

Divisors of 45323718554047

  • Number of divisors d(n): 2
  • Complete list of divisors:
  • Sum of all divisors σ(n): 45323718554048
  • Sum of proper divisors (its aliquot sum) s(n): 1
  • 45323718554047 is a deficient number, because the sum of its proper divisors (1) is less than itself. Its deficiency is 45323718554046

Bases of 45323718554047

  • Binary: 10100100111000110000000010010011110001101111112
  • Hexadecimal: 0x2938C024F1BF
  • Base-36: G2DFFSX4V

Squares and roots of 45323718554047

  • 45323718554047 squared (453237185540472) is 2054239463566464280460078209
  • 45323718554047 cubed (453237185540473) is 93105771289302913375254330198726013461823
  • The square root of 45323718554047 is 6732289.2506224805
  • The cube root of 45323718554047 is 35654.0206228393
